SWITZERLAND
Photogrammetric Instruments Manufac
tured in Switzerland and Changes
Made Since 1961
WILD HEERBRUGG, INC., HEERBRUGG
cameras. RC8 Aerial Camera—automatic
film camera with interchangeable lens cones:
21 cm. Aviotar, 18X18 cm.; 11.5 cm. Avio
gon, 18X18 cm.; 6 in. Aviogon, 9X9 in.
Objectives for infrared photography: same
characteristics as above.
Changes: Universal suspension device
(camera mount to kill vibrations, etc.); Stato-
scope and horizon camera. Navigation tele
scope with detachable head; Kodak projec
tion apparatus for using horizon photography.
APPARATUS FOR TRANSFORMATION OF IMAGES.
(Reducing-Enlarging) Image Transformers
U3 and U4. U3, no change. U4, with auto
matic adjustment of contrast by electronic
method, the “Cintel System.”
E4 Rectification Camera (New). Equation
of conjugate points and Scheimflug condition
are introduced electronically, which permits
simplified construction.
Enlarger VGI. Change: Projection table is
provided with a depression device making the
sensitized paper strictly flat.
stereoplotting machines—(Camera) (Plot
ter)
Allograph B8—for plotting wide-angle pho
tography and super-wide angular photogra
phy without reducing size of photos. Changes:
addition of large linear pantograph; move
ment of tracing pencil along the bearing arm
is controlled by a wire of invariable length,
which makes the construction very light. The
ratio of enlargement can go to 1:5.
Stereomat (In Research)
Transfer Apparatus PUG 3. For transferr
ing passpoints from one photo to the other in
aerial triangulation.
KERN & CIE S.A., AARAU
Stereorestituteur RGI—First-order plotting
equipment. No change.
Stereorestituteur PG2—Second-order plot
ting equipment. No change.
G. GORADI AG., ZURICH
Coradomat (New)—Coordinatograph for
transferring points by orthogonal coordi
nates. Finger control of transfer and drawing
straight lines. Conversion of scales. Measure
ment of coordinates of points shown on a
plan.
Digimeter (New)—Apparatus to measure
coordinates of points shown on a plan for
computing area of lots.
